SQL_COMPAT 廣域變數

此內建廣域變數指定 SQL 相容模式。 其值會決定套用至 SQL 查詢的語法規則集。

此廣域變數具有下列性質:
  • 它是一個讀寫變數,其值由使用者維護。
  • 類型是 VARCHAR (3)。
  • 綱目是 SYSIBM。
  • 此廣域變數的範圍是階段作業。
  • 它具有預設值 NULL。
此廣域變數必須具有值 NULL、'DB2' 'NPS' (SQLSTATE 42815)。
NULL
使用預設值 ('DB2')。
'DB2'
Db2® 語法規則會套用至 SQL 查詢。
'NPS'
Netezza 語法規則適用於 SQL 查詢。 如果您使用此設定,部分 SQL 行為將不同於 SQL 參照資訊中所記載的行為。 若要判定相容性特性對 SQL 應用程式的潛在影響,請參閱 Netezza的相容性特性